Frank Harder Obituary

Published by Legacy Remembers on Jun. 6, 2016.
Frank J. Harder was born on May 18, 1913 in Butterfield, MN to John and Anna (Heppner) Harder. He attended country school in rural Butterfield through the eighth grade. Frank farmed with his brother, Ed until he got married. On August 25, 1943, Frank was united in marriage to Elva Mohlenbrock in Mountain Lake, MN. To this union they where blessed with three children. The family farmed near Comfrey where Frank was on the school board for 14 years. In 1965, they moved to Alexandria and owned and operated Harder?s Resort on Lake Cowdry. He also built a mobile home park, drove school bus and later in life drove for the county to bring people to medical facilities and sold real estate for Ken Tessmer. Frank loved to fix things, woodworking, and playing pranks on people. He also enjoyed playing rummy, traveling by car and keeping the car polished. Most of all Frank loved being with his children and grandchildren. Frank died on Wednesday, April 22, 2009 at Bethany Home in Alexandria at the age of 95. He is survived by his sons, Rodney (Wilma) Harder of Santa Fe, NM and Charles Harder of East Troy, WI; daughter, Rocksie Gall of Papillion, NE; 8 grandchildren; and 9 great-grandchildren. Frank is preceded in death by his parents, John and Anna; wife, Elva; brothers, Diedrich, Ed, and Aaron; and sisters, Elizabeth, Anna, Marie, and Katherine. A funeral service was held on Monday, April 27, 2009 at the Anderson Funeral Home Chapel in Alexandria with Reverend Mark Astrup officiating and organist, Becky Worley. Interment was in the Evergreen Cemetery. Casket bearers were Frank?s grandchildren, Jason Motl, Travis Harder, Ian Harder, David Gall, Michael Gall, Robert Gall, Joshua Harder and Chelsea Harder. Honorary casket bearers were Frank?s great-grandchildren, Tatyana Gall, Benjamin Gall, Lilliana Gall, Isabella Gall, Micah Gall, Payton Gall, Jack Motl, Kayla Harder, and Abigail Harder. Arrangements are with the Anderson Funeral Home in Alexandria.
